I'm sorry it's very difficult going though these times. As they have said to you, it could be the start of a loss or it could be fine. You might have a subchorionic haematoma which can cause quite a lot of bleeding. Having had bleeding and then a subsequent good scan is reassuring for you. Perhaps give your own EPU a call in the morning and talk to them about the situation. As they have already seen you they may be more willing to see you again sooner. I'm not sure what their policies are but bleeding in pregnancy is very common but nonetheless absolutely anxiety inducing. How many weeks are you?
